2009-04-09

Tkinter--基本觀念

Tkinter是Python的de facto GUI標準,大多數有Python的地方都有它!而且在WinCE上也可以直接套用!所以最近我開始學習,以便希望可以寫出一個小程式,可以同時在PC跟Mobile Phone上跑。

設計GUI程式時,會有以下基本動作要完成。

當開發使用者介面(UI)時,是有一些標準動作要完成。

1) 你得決定這UI'看'起來像啥! 這代表你需要撰寫程式碼來決定使用者會在電腦螢幕上看到什麼!

2) 你得決定讓這UI'作'什麼!這表示你要寫哪些程序來實現程式的工作。

3) 你要協調這些'視覺'與'工作'!代表你必須寫程式碼來協調以便透過這些視覺與程序來完成此程式的工作

4) 最後,你要寫程式碼好讓這程式會坐下來且等待使用者輸入些什麼!

而讓我們看一個最簡單的Tkinter程式


from Tkinter import *

root = Tk()
root.mainloop()


夠簡單吧,它就會產生一個我們很熟悉的視窗在你螢幕上!!!

沒有留言: